A Manufacturing Engineer is primarily responsible for developing and improving manufacturing processes by studying product and manufacturing methods. They work closely with the design and production teams to ensure that products are manufactured efficiently and to the right quality standards. A Manufacturing Engineer uses their skills to evaluate manufacturing processes, design and implement cost-saving changes, ensure worker safety, and troubleshoot issues on the production line. They also play a vital role in the introduction of new products, helping to design and set up production processes.
Important skills for a Manufacturing Engineer include problem-solving, project management, and proficiency in data analysis and CAD software. They typically hold a degree in Manufacturing Engineering or a related field, and industry certifications such as Certified Manufacturing Engineer (CMfgE) or Lean Six Sigma can be beneficial. Before becoming a Manufacturing Engineer, one may have roles such as Production Supervisor, Quality Control Inspector, or Process Engineer, which provide essential experience and skills in production operations, quality assurance, and process design and improvement.
